Shields Strikes Out 13, Beats Verdugo Hills
- Share via
Jeremy Shields pitched a three-hitter and struck out 13 for Newhall Saugus in a 13-0 District 20 victory over Verdugo Hills on Thursday at Canyon High.
Chris Wright had three hits, including a home run, and drove in two runs for Newhall Saugus (8-4), which scored eight runs in the seventh inning.
Studio City North 4, Panorama City 3--Chris Cervantes pitched a six-hitter, striking out nine for Studio City North in a District 20 game at Sylmar High.
Cervantes (3-1) added two hits and Sam Ponce had two RBIs for Studio City North (8-3).
Valencia 5, San Fernando 1--Bucky Downs had two hits for Valencia (5-5) in a District 20 game at San Fernando High.
North Hollywood East 15, Agoura Oaks 11--Matt Berkson, Adam Siegel and Jay Levine each had three hits for North Hollywood East in a District 20 game at Agoura High.
Matt Felder had a three-run double for North Hollywood East.
Royal 4, Simi Valley 1--Brett Wayne had two doubles, two RBIs and scored two runs for Royal (5-1) in a District 16 game at Royal High.
Mike Byer pitched three hitless innings, Russell O’Brien (1-0) pitched two shutout innings and Bob Egan, who also had two hits, earned his first save, striking out the side in the seventh for Royal.
Moorpark 7, Newbury Park 7--Trailing, 5-0, Newbury Park rallied in a District 16 game halted by darkness after nine innings at Newbury Park High.
Anthony Foli had three hits and four RBIs, and Joey Hamer added three hits, including a double, and scored three runs for Newbury Park (6-4-1).
Tim McLain had a grand slam and a two-run double, and Zack Greene added three hits for Moorpark (4-6-1).
